“කොහාට හරි” (kohāṭa hari) — to somewhere in Sinhala. Adverb, level A1. The pair to kohē hari: kohāṭa? asks 'where to', and the same hari turns the question into 'to somewhere'. In a live sentence: “එයා කොහාට හරි ගියා” — He went off to somewhere. You can hear how it sounds right here. Written with the characters ක, ො, හ, ා, ට, හ, ර, ි.
